数据库用什么软件做
-
数据库可以使用多种软件来进行管理和操作。以下是几种常见的数据库软件:
-
MySQL:MySQL是一种开源的关系型数据库管理系统。它具有高性能、可靠性和易用性的特点,被广泛应用于各种规模的应用程序和网站开发中。
-
Oracle Database:Oracle Database是一种商业级的关系型数据库管理系统。它具有强大的功能和性能,适用于大型企业级应用程序和数据仓库。
-
Microsoft SQL Server:Microsoft SQL Server是微软公司开发的关系型数据库管理系统。它具有良好的集成性和易用性,适用于Windows操作系统环境下的应用程序开发。
-
MongoDB:MongoDB是一种开源的文档数据库,它使用面向文档的数据模型,适合处理半结构化数据。MongoDB具有高可用性、可扩展性和灵活性的特点,被广泛应用于Web应用程序和大数据处理。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有高度的可扩展性和安全性。它支持丰富的数据类型和功能,适用于各种复杂的数据处理需求。
-
SQLite:SQLite是一种嵌入式的关系型数据库管理系统,它以文件形式存储数据,无需独立的服务器进程。SQLite具有轻量级、易部署和快速的特点,适用于移动应用程序和嵌入式系统。
这些数据库软件在不同的应用场景中具有各自的优势和特点,选择适合自己需求的数据库软件能够提高数据管理和处理效率,确保数据的安全和稳定性。
1年前 -
-
数据库可以使用多种软件来实现。以下是几种常见的数据库软件:
-
MySQL:MySQL是一种开源关系型数据库管理系统(RDBMS),它支持多用户、多线程和多表等功能。MySQL具有良好的性能和可靠性,并且易于安装和使用。它适用于小型到大型企业应用。
-
Oracle:Oracle是一种功能强大的商业关系型数据库管理系统,被广泛用于大型企业级应用。Oracle具有高性能、高可用性和高安全性,并且支持分布式数据库和数据复制等高级功能。
-
Microsoft SQL Server:Microsoft SQL Server是由微软开发的关系型数据库管理系统,适用于Windows操作系统。它具有高性能、高可用性和高安全性,并且与其他Microsoft产品(如.NET框架)紧密集成。
-
PostgreSQL:PostgreSQL是一种开源关系型数据库管理系统,具有良好的可扩展性和可靠性。它支持复杂的查询和高级特性,如触发器、存储过程和复制等。
-
MongoDB:MongoDB是一种非关系型数据库,采用文档存储模式。它适用于大量非结构化数据和需要高度伸缩性的应用场景。MongoDB具有灵活的数据模型和高效的查询性能。
选择合适的数据库软件取决于具体的应用需求、性能要求、数据模型和预算等因素。在做决策时,需要综合考虑这些因素,并进行适当的评估和测试。
1年前 -
-
数据库可以使用多种软件进行管理和操作,其中最常用的数据库软件有以下几种:
-
MySQL:MySQL是一种开源的关系型数据库管理系统(RDBMS),它是最流行的数据库之一。MySQL具有良好的性能和可靠性,支持多种操作系统,并且易于安装和使用。它广泛应用于Web应用程序、嵌入式系统等领域。
-
Oracle:Oracle是一种商业化的关系型数据库管理系统,它具有强大的功能和高度的可伸缩性。Oracle数据库支持大型企业级应用程序,并提供高级的安全性和数据管理功能。
-
Microsoft SQL Server:Microsoft SQL Server是由Microsoft开发和提供的关系型数据库管理系统。它广泛应用于Windows环境下的企业级应用程序,并具有良好的可扩展性和性能。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有高度的可扩展性和灵活性。它支持多种操作系统,并提供高级的数据完整性和安全性。
-
MongoDB:MongoDB是一种开源的文档型数据库,它采用了NoSQL的数据存储方式。MongoDB具有高度的可扩展性和灵活性,适用于大规模的分布式应用程序。
除了以上列举的数据库软件,还有许多其他的数据库软件可供选择,如SQLite、Redis等。选择数据库软件时,需要根据实际需求和项目要求来进行评估和选择。需要考虑的因素包括性能、可靠性、安全性、扩展性、成本等。
1年前 -